What does EQUINIX INC (EQIX)'s 8-K filed February 12, 2026 say?

Item 5.02: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ers – The filing reports personnel or governance changes at Equinix, including potential changes to the board of directors or executive officer positions and related compensation matters. What are the main risks flagged in EQIX's 8-K?

Notable risk changes: Adoption of formal Executive Severance Plan creating structured severance framework with defined multiples (1x for standard terminations, 2x for Change in Control) - increases transparency but formalizes contingent liabilities; CEO severance agreement amended to align with broader executive plan, including 12-month continued equity vesting post-termination and removal of 3-year term limit -…
